Changemanagement consulting experts know that individual talent alone does not always equate to team performance. Even if changes are viewed as positive, every change begins by people needing to leave behind the way things were. This creates a sense of loss that must be managed during the transition.

employees, almost one-third don’t understand why these changes are happening. This can be detrimental for any company trying to implement change. When employees don’t understand why changes are happening, it can be a barrier to driving ownership and commitment and can even result in resistance or push back.
